Here’s a closer look at the features and benefits of the Original Type S Iron heads......
High Moment of Inertia. Gives you a more stable iron head that resists twisting on off center hits, thereby increasing accuracy.
Low Center of Gravity. Helps you get the ball in the air quicker, especially in the long irons. Also helps deliver a solid feel across the face.
Two-way Cambered Sole Design. Allows for easy set up at address and reduced drag through impact. This is especially helpful from awkward side hill lies.
Wide Sole. Helps to prevent digging on those fat or heavy shots. Makes getting the ball in the air easier, especially with the long irons.
Moderate Offset Progression. Gives you the advantage of some offset in the long irons for improved trajectory, with minimal offset in the wedges and a more penetrating ball flight.
Perimeter Weighted Design. The weight distribution to the perimeter and down low makes the design very forgiving and solid feeling at impact.
Grade A 431 Stainless Steel. Brings out the solid feel a player is looking for and allows for adjustment of lie and loft.
